What this Trial Is About
This research aims to understand micro-expressions in patients with prolonged disorders of consciousness. It focuses on how emotional stimuli might induce micro-expression changes in these patients and uses these changes to classify levels of consciousness. The study also seeks to assist clinical diagnosis by detecting micro-expressions and explore residual brain function through monitoring these expressions, supported by assessments like the CRS-R scale. About 200 participants will be involved, including 150 patients with consciousness disorders and 50 healthy controls matched by age and gender. Participants will undergo assessments using the CRS-R scale to evaluate auditory, visual, motor, speech responsiveness, communication, and arousal levels. Researchers will record facial expressions, collect EEG data, and perform MRI scans during exposure to various emotional stimuli. The study dataset will be split into training and testing sets using machine learning methods. The study includes both patients with disorders of consciousness and healthy participants as control subjects. During the study, participants will have multiple CRS-R assessments and their micro-expressions monitored. Follow-up evaluations using the CRS-R and GOS scales will be conducted over a six-month period to track progress. Researchers will analyze the GOSE and CRS-R scores at six months as primary outcomes. General participant information, including medical and family history, will also be collected to support the research objectives.

Who Can Participate
Eligibility Criteria
You may qualify if you...
- Patients with consciousness disorders for more than 28 days following severe brain injury, assessed by the CRS-R scale to meet the criteria for VS or MCS
- Aged between 18 and 80 years
- Stable vital signs
- Voluntary participation of family members with signed informed consent
- Good cooperation, minimal facial and spontaneous activities, no use of antiepileptic or sedative drugs
You will not qualify if you...
- Locked-in syndrome
- Contraindications for EEG examination
- Contraindications for MRI scanning, such as the presence of internal metallic implants
- Diseases and factors that may affect brain function assessment, such as metabolic disorders, poisoning, shock, etc.
